Transaction 23eb0593f2f2d831cf790b630d32f4aae1eddbfc156bb3ef170c52ab55676d9b

2 Input
1 Outputs
  • 23eb0593f2f2d831cf790b630d32f4aae1eddbfc156bb3ef170c52ab55676d9b:0
  • value  6531351
    address  3K4DZcDCFRUPHRi3sSJFwkDoNchxmhTkqu